TAH BSO

I'm listing my surgery as TAH BSO but only because there wasn't an abbreviation for my surgery. At the age of 23 I had a TVH. After this surgery I developed cysts on my ovaries like clockwork and had major bladder and urethra tube problems. This continued for 13 years. I finally found an OBY/GYN that really checked me out and LISTENED. He determined that my ovaries were going to continue to produce cysts and therefore the vicious cycle of pain would continue. On Feb. 25 went to hospital to undergo surgery. Got there at 8, surgery was to be at 9, emergency occurred and surgery finally was at 11. Came through surgery fine, removed ovaries (which were covered in cysts), tubes, and tons of adhesions. Some of the adhesions were so firmly wrapped around my bowels, Dr. thought he would have to remove some of my bowels- he was great removed only adhesions. He also had to remove some suspicious places from bladder. (Turned out to be calcified stitches from previous surgery) Came home on 3rd day feeling great. 4th day gas hit with a vengeance! I thought I was having a heart attack! It moved over my right shoulder, down my back and into my lower abdomen. My stomach become even more swollen and gas actually made my stomach move (looked like a roller coaster in there) Incision started oozing after staples were removed (8-inch incision with 20 staples) Continued to ooze for about four days. Began Estradiol 1mg. patch 3rd day after surgery. Don't know yet how well this is going to work. It is day 19 and I am going stir
crazy, but finding that I hurt more now than first week. Guess it is the stitches dissolving and healing going on. Looking forward to going back to work part-time. I teach 3rd. graders and miss them a lot! My worry now is getting rid of this HUGE tummy by my sons wedding in May. Best of luck to all that have
been through this and are getting ready to go through it.
